Description

4 and 4A East Fergus Place in Kirkcaldy is a villa built around 1830. It is a two-storey, three-bay building with a rectangular plan and features both a piend and a platform roof. The exterior is harled, with quoins strips and stone margins, and includes a base course and eaves cornice. Notable architectural details include hoodmoulds and stone mullions.

The west elevation is symmetrical, featuring a pilastered and corniced doorway at the center, which has a deep-set panelled timber door and a small-pane fanlight above. Flanking the doorway are hoodmoulded tripartite windows. The first floor has regular fenestration and a full-width decorative wrought-iron balcony supported by cast-iron scroll brackets. To the outer left, there is a deeply recessed entrance bay with a door at ground level and a window above.

The east elevation displays asymmetrical fenestration, including a small piended extension on the ground right side. The windows are timber sash and case with a 12-pane glazing pattern. The roof is covered with grey slates, and there are coped ashlar stacks with some polygonal cans.

The boundary walls consist of low saddleback-coped harled walls on the west side and coped rubble walls elsewhere. The statutory listing address was revised in 2019, and the property was previously listed as 4 East Fergus Place, which included the balcony and boundary walls.
